This fun-filled unauthorized biography and fact book, inspired by the sensational YouTube channel MrBeast, is chock-full of weird and wacky trivia about the locations and challenges featured in his top-viewed videos. Perfect for fans of Who Would Win or Weird But True, the devoted MrBeast watcher on a deep dive, or the casual bystander thinking “wait…he did what?!”
Dive into the world behind the sensational YouTube channel MrBeast in this illustrated book of fun facts perfect for die-hard fans and newcomers alike!
You may know MrBeast, the YouTube mega-sensation with millions and millions of views...but how much do you know about the world behind his videos? This book of fun facts inspired by the YouTube channel plays on themes present in his most-watched videos, from the pyramids of Egypt to the Bermuda Triangle, to being buried alive, to how long it really takes to count to a hundred thousand.
Learn the wild, the wacky, and the just plain weird facts and trivia behind his video topics! Perfect for the kid devouring Ripley’s Believe It or Not! or Guinness World Records, the devoted MrBeast watcher on a deep dive, or the casual bystander thinking “wait…he did what?!”.
This book is not authorized, endorsed, or sponsored by any person or entity owning or controlling any rights in the MrBeast name, products, or trademarks.

About the Author
Patty Michaels is a children’s book writer and editor who lives in the New York City area. She loves the beach, coffee, her family, and playing with her dogs.
Ceej Rowland has been a practicing illustrator for the past ten years and has been drawing in general for much longer than that. Taking inspiration from people and their surroundings, he gets a real kick out of capturing the little details that make a piece of work stand out, learning new processes, and challenging his comfort zone whenever he gets the chance. Growing up, he surrounded himself with comics, pictorial reference books, and illustrated literature, so being able to use his creativity to make a living is a childhood dream come true. Today, Ceej resides in Dorset, on the south coast of England. When he’s not hunched over the desk in his studio, or happily sketching in the quiet corner of a coffee shop, he spends time with his family and friends—heading to the beach, exploring the surrounding countryside, or returning to the city for a culture top-up.
